Morteza Khaladj, DPM, FACPPM

Dr. Khaladj has travelled and shared his knowledge internationally by acting as a humanitarian medical aid in Ukrain from 1989 to 1991 and has lectured on chronic wounds since 2004 until the present time. As a visiting professor, Dr. Khaladj has lectured in colleges and universities across Iran.
In New Jersey, Dr. Khaladj is the acting director for the Podiatry Residency Program and Trinitas Regional hospital chief of Podiatry. He also participates in the state of the art wound care center located at Trinitas Regional Medical Center. Other services Dr. Khaladj offers includes: routine foot care and elective surgeries: Bunionectomy, hammertoe deformities, all different types of oseous deformities, tendon tear, sport related injuries, fractures, limb salvage procedures, diabetic ulcers, bacterial/fungal infections of the lower extremity, complicated chronic lower extremity treatment of all types of chronic wounds and orthotics.
